What do Venezuelans call each other?
In Venezuela “pana” means “friend, pal, buddy, mate”. If you want to say “Juan is my buddy” you can say “Juan es mi pana”.
What does PANA mean in Venezuela?
Pana. Pana can be as simple as saying “friend,” or describing someone as “friendly.” Ex: “He’s super pana.”
Can you call a girl Bonita?
Guapa(o) is, most of the time, used for young people and especially for men (i.e., the masculine form guapo, at least in some regions). Guapa can be used for females and it isn’t considered weird or uncommon, but bonita for females is preferred over guapa, just as guapo is preferred over bonito for males.
Can you call a girl Hermosa?
Bonita is closer to beautiful, lindo to cute or nice, and hermosa to gorgeous. All three can be said about people, pets, or things, but hermosa in particular can carry a note of seduction or sexuality, depending on the situation.

What does Vale mean in Venezuela?
Vale. This one is used so much it is barely even a slang word, but it is rarely used in South or Central America so is worth learning if you are used to Latin American Spanish. Spaniards use this interjection all the time to mean ‘OK’, ‘fine’ or ‘good’.
How do Venezuelans say friend?
Venezuelans don’t usually say the word amigo (friend), they would rather use one of these three words when referring to a close friend: chamo, pana, marico.
What do Venezuelans call popcorn?
16) Cotufas
This means “popcorn” in Venezuela. It comes from the English sacks of corns which have an inscription “corn to fry”.

What is the meaning of Chamo?
It’s the word we use to refer to someone and it’s quite informal. It means “boy or young man” (if it’s Chamo) or “young woman or girl” (if it’s Chama).
What’s mamacita mean?
little mother
The literal translation of mamacita is “little mother” but the figurative and more accurate translation is “hot momma.” The moniker is never really used to describe an actual mother, a genuine mamá or mamita. Instead, the word is inextricably linked to a man’s perception of a woman as an object of sexual desire.
Does Bella mean beautiful in Spanish?
Bello/bella is a safe, all-purpose word that you can use to mean “beautiful” or “lovely”. It’s a bit formal, especially in Spain, but it can describe anything: beautiful people, beautiful clothes, a beautiful view, a beautiful mind. There’s also a closely-related noun belleza, which means “beauty”.
What is the difference between Bonita and Linda?
Bonita means ‘pretty‘, ‘lovely’ or ‘nice’. Linda means ‘sweet’, ‘nice’ or ‘cute’ and it talks about attractiveness in an endearing way. Hermosa expresses a higher degree of beauty. It means ‘beautiful’ or ‘gorgeous’.
